Cairn And Eni Plug Mexico Well After Drilling Finds It Barren

5th May 2020 10:02

(Alliance News) - Cairn Energy PLC on Tuesday said it an exploration project in Mexico has been abandoned after disappointing findings during drilling.

Cairn reported that work at the Ehecatl-1 exploration well, operated by Eni Spa and located in the Sureste Basin Offshore Mexico, has been completed. Cairn has a 30% stake in the project.

Cairn said: "The exploration target of the well was to prove hydrocarbons in the Lower Miocene. The well did not find reservoired hydrocarbons and it has now been permanently plugged and abandoned.

"Logging, sampling and data collection during the well operations will help the joint venture calibrate the seismic data and develop an improved understanding of the Lower Miocene target and the information gathered will be integrated to improve the understanding of the block and inform the second well decision."

Cairn shares were 4.5% higher at 118.50 pence each in London on Tuesday morning. Eni shares in Milan were 3.4% at EUR8.49.
